Job Title: Actuarial Analyst

Location: New York City (Hybrid Model)

Job Description:

We are seeking a motivated and detail-oriented Actuarial Analyst to join our client's team at a leading insurance firm. This role offers a unique opportunity to work on pricing for reinsurance contracts while leveraging your coding skills in VBA, SQL, or Python. The position is based in New York City and follows a hybrid work model, providing flexibility and a balanced work-life environment.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Conduct pricing analysis for reinsurance contracts.
  • Develop and maintain actuarial models using VBA, SQL, or Python.
  • Collaborate with underwriters, actuaries, and other stakeholders to ensure accurate pricing and risk assessment.
  • Analyze data to identify trends and provide insights for decision-making.
  • Assist in the preparation of reports and presentations for senior management.
  • Stay updated with industry trends and regulatory changes affecting reinsurance pricing.

Qualifications:

  • 0-3 years of actuarial experience.
  • Passed 1-3 actuarial exams.
  • Proficiency in VBA, SQL, or Python preferred but not required.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
  • Detail-oriented with a commitment to accuracy.

Benefits:

  • Competitive salary and performance-based bonuses.
  • Comprehensive health, dental, and vision insurance.
  • Retirement savings plan with company match.
  • Professional development opportunities.
  • Flexible hybrid work model.
